WebAn ABA Routing Number will only be issued to a federal or state chartered financial institution which is eligible to maintain an account at a Federal Reserve Bank. Decoading an ABA Routing Number. The first four digit of the ABA/Routing Number is assigned by the Federal Reserve Routing System and represent the bank's physical location. WebSWIFT Codes and BIC codes are part of the ISO 9362 standards for sending money internationally. SWIFT stands for Society for Worldwide Interbank Financial Telecommunication, while BIC is short for Bank Identifier Code. SWIFT and BIC codes are used all over the world to identify bank branches when you make international …
